Soulseek NodeJS client

A modern NodeJS client for the Soulseek peer-to-peer network, written in TypeScript with a fully promise-based (async/await) API and complete TypeScript type declarations.
Features
- File Search: Search the distributed Soulseek network with exclusion keywords and attribute filters.
- File Downloads: Reliable downloads supporting streaming, queueing, automatic retries, and resume on interrupted transfers.
- File Sharing: Share files from the local filesystem (
fsShareProvider), memory (memoryShareProvider), or custom providers (e.g. S3 / database). - Upload Queue: Serve shared files with configurable slots and per-peer queue limits.
- Private Messaging: Send and receive private messages through the Soulseek server.
- Self-Documented: Comprehensive TypeScript types and JSDoc annotations for all options, methods, and events right in your editor.

Getting Started
You must already have a Soulseek account before using this module.
import { SlskClient, FileAttribute } from 'slsk-client'
const client = new SlskClient()
await client.login('myUsername', 'myPassword')
// Search for files
const results = await client.search({
req: 'random track',
timeout: 4000
})
// Filter or sort results (e.g., 320kbps MP3s)
const bestResult = results
.filter(r => r.attribs[FileAttribute.Bitrate] === 320)
.sort((a, b) => (b.speed ?? 0) - (a.speed ?? 0))[0]
// Download
if (bestResult) {
const download = client.download({
...bestResult,
path: '/path/to/save/song.mp3'
})
download.on('progress', ({ progress }) => {
console.log(`Progress: ${Math.round((progress ?? 0) * 100)}%`)
})
const { path, buffer } = await download
console.log(`Saved to ${path}`)
}
Usage
Downloading
The download() method returns a Download instance that can be awaited as a Promise or used as a stream:
// Follow transfer events
const download = client.download({ ...result, path: '/tmp/song.mp3' })
download.on('status', status => console.log('Status:', status)) // queued, connected, downloading, complete
download.on('queue', place => console.log(`Queue position: ${place}`))
download.on('progress', ({ progress }) => console.log(`${Math.round((progress ?? 0) * 100)}%`))
const res = await download
// Or stream directly (e.g., pipe to an HTTP response or custom write stream)
client.download(result).stream.pipe(writableStream)
// Resuming a partial download
const offset = (await fs.promises.stat(partialPath)).size
await client.download({ ...result, path: partialPath, offset })
// Cancelling with AbortSignal
await client.download({ ...result, signal: AbortSignal.timeout(30000) })
Sharing and Uploading
Files can be shared using built-in or custom share providers:
import { SlskClient, fsShareProvider, memoryShareProvider } from 'slsk-client'
const client = new SlskClient({
shares: [
fsShareProvider({ folders: ['/home/me/music'], root: 'music' }),
memoryShareProvider({ 'jingles\\intro.mp3': introBuffer })
],
// Enable uploading shared files to requesting peers
uploads: {
slots: 2, // Concurrent upload slots
queueLimit: 50 // Max queued files per peer
}
})
await client.login('myUsername', 'myPassword')
// Track upload activity
client.on('upload-queued', ({ user, file, place }) => console.log(`${user} queued ${file} at ${place}`))
client.on('upload-progress', ({ user, file, progress }) => console.log(`${file}: ${Math.round(progress * 100)}%`))
client.on('upload-complete', ({ user, file }) => console.log(`Finished uploading ${file} to ${user}`))
Private Messages
// Receive messages
client.on('private-message', ({ user, message, sentAt, pending }) => {
console.log(`[${sentAt.toISOString()}] ${user}: ${message}`)
client.sendPrivateMessage(user, 'Thanks for your message!')
})
// Send a message
client.sendPrivateMessage('anotherUser', 'Hello!')
Client Events
SlskClient extends EventEmitter with strongly typed events:
client.on('found', result => console.log('Found:', result.file))
client.on('server-error', err => console.error('Server error:', err))
client.on('server-disconnect', ({ reconnecting }) => console.log('Disconnected, reconnecting:', reconnecting))
client.on('server-reconnect', () => console.log('Reconnected to Soulseek'))

Debugging
The library uses the debug package. Set the DEBUG environment variable to inspect internal logs:
DEBUG=slsk:* node app.js # Log everything
DEBUG=slsk:server node app.js # Server connection logs
DEBUG=slsk:peer:* node app.js # Peer connection logs
DEBUG=slsk:download node app.js # Download logs
DEBUG=slsk:upload node app.js # Upload logs
